alignointialgoritmien
Alignment algorithms, often referred to as alignointialgoritmien in some contexts, are a class of computational methods used to find similarities between two or more sequences. These sequences can represent various forms of data, most commonly biological sequences like DNA, RNA, or proteins, but also text strings or other ordered data. The primary goal of alignment algorithms is to arrange these sequences to identify regions of homology, which can indicate functional, structural, or evolutionary relationships.
There are two main types of sequence alignment: global alignment and local alignment. Global alignment aims
The algorithms typically employ dynamic programming techniques. These methods build up a solution by solving smaller